Masson Lees Quarry is, apparently, possibly the premier dry-tooling venue in the Englishland. Dry-tooling in itself is a unique climbing sport but many of the skills used are also those used in some of the intermediate+ winter climbing grades. Dry tooling can also be done on wet rock, so much as much weather dependant.

What is dry-tooling: Climbing using ice axes but on rock.

What to bring: Harness, helmet, belay plate, footwear (see below). We have some climbing axes and mono-point crampons for people to use but if you have a pair of climbing axes and/or some mono-point crampons bring them along.

Footwear: There are a few routes you can wear climbing shoes but it'll be best to bring along some B2 or B3 mountaineering boots.
